  • Creating an organization web page

    Organizations may create their own web page through UL. A web liaison must be established to communicate with the University Web Master. The role of the web liaison is to present the needs of the organization, seek technical advice as needed, and maintain the Web pages and related files of the department or organization. The role of the University Web Master is to represent the interest of the University, provide information relevant to Web publishing, and espouse efficient use of Web resources.

     

    Go to this http://ull.edu/Web/Policy/  for instructions on creating a web page. If an organization establishes a website off of the UL website please notify the Dean of Students Office (Martin Hall 211) of the url address so they may link the page to the UL Student Life web site.

     

    Organization email addresses

    The organization president or designated officer may create an alias to their UL email. For example the University Program Council may create upc@louisiana.edu as an alias for the president of UPC. When a new president is elected the alias is changed to the new person.
